The Human Habitat is a foundational work in the field of human geography that explores the intricate relationship between the physical environment and the development of human societies. Written by the influential geographer Ellsworth Huntington, this study examines how climate, topography, and natural resources shape the distribution of populations, the growth of civilizations, and the distinct characteristics of different cultures.
Huntington delves into the concept of environmental determinism, arguing that the physical world is not merely a backdrop for human history but a primary driver of social and economic progress. Through a series of insightful observations and analyses, the book investigates why certain regions of the globe have become centers of innovation and power while others have lagged behind. It addresses the impact of heat, cold, and seasonal changes on human energy and health, offering a comprehensive look at the interplay between nature and nurture on a global scale.
The Human Habitat remains a significant text for those interested in the history of geographic thought, anthropology, and the environmental factors that influence the course of human evolution and societal structure.
